Hogbay Posted August 16, 2022 #135 Share Posted August 16, 2022 4 hours ago, imacruiser4347 said: Maybe! We have never been in the Southern Hemisphere, and Carnival Splendor has a cruise June 2023 out of Sydney we're interested in. My wife HATES the cold and the weather will play a role in her enjoyment. I'm trying to get an idea of what to expect weather-wise. June sailing out of Sydney 4pm would be fresh, pants/jeans and jacket 13°c( 55 ° f) but some Aussie will be still in shorts and flip flops .Arlie Beach would be 25°c (77°f) average max during the day ,shorts and swim wear but i take a spray jacket/ wind cheater for early morning tender transfer and return . September spring would be the best time with January summer, too hot and humid. I have several bookings for June 2023 .
